Die casting process

Molten metal is injected under high pressure into a steel mold (die). – Rated in “Clamping tons”

Amount of pressure they can exert on the die Capacity 400 tons to 4000 tons

Page 3: Die casting

Alloys

Aluminum & magnesium– Substitute for ferrous casting (automotive sector)– Weight reduction

Magnesium & titanium – Automotive & Aerospace markets

Aluminum – lithium alloys – Meeting requirements in aircraft industry (reducing

structural weight).

Ceramic composite die

A unique nitride / nitride – carbide matrix– Half the weight of

conventional steel dies & 10 times the useful life.

– Proven stability to molten metals, resistant to corrosion, erosion, oxidation, thermal fatigue and cracking.

Page 6: Die casting

Titanium matrix composite tooling

– CermeTi Implemented in the form of shot sleeve or a partial liner

inserted into an existing H13 shot sleeve. (minimum 4 times cast life).
